Abstract :
With the rapid economic development, the inequality between water resource and other economic factors become increasingly prominent. Based on the Gini coefficient, three indexes, including the "water - economic" Gini coefficient between water resources and population, irrigation area and GDP respectively, are adopted to built a loop iteration model for the optimal allocation of water resources. And the calculation and analysis for the Chang-Ji Urban agglomeration are conducted. The calculation result shows that the "water - economic" Gini coefficient after the optimal allocation of water resources shows correspondingly high match than before extremely unmatched relationship.
